Lower Back Pain Cure - 4 Effective Remedies
Lower back pain is definitely an illness that could possibly strike nearly everyone at some point or the other.
Now the lower back refers to the section that joins the lower body to the upper part of the body.
Moreover it is the lower back, which actually takes a significant degree of the body's weight.
It is for this very reason that it is far more prone to injury in case we lift, bend or twist in an incorrect manner.
Most of us invest plenty of time behind obtaining treatment for the pain in the lower back area.
Luckily, a great deal of the pain in the lower back disappears inside of a couple of weeks of taking the necessary lower backache treatment, unless some injury has happened.
In case you are suffering from lower backache and it does not go away in a couple of weeks, then you should certainly call on a doctor.
Normally, lower back pain happens on account of an injury, a strain, or overdoing things in relation to your back like lifting heavy things continuously or constantly adopting a wrong bending posture.
A majority of individuals, who take to sports, when they in fact are not familiar with the game, tend to injure their lower back area and need low backache treatment.
Now as we grow older, our bones and muscles become weak, and this makes them more vulnerable to the risk of injury.
Further, the discs that lie between the vertebrae tend to weaken due to constant use right through one's lifetime.
Once these discs are damaged, they frequently place a strain on the lower back area.
Lower backache treatment is the need of the hour in such circumstances since a damaged disc can be very hurtful.
A number of times, a broken or damaged disc may need surgery as a part of the lower backache cure.
Lower back treatment entails putting an ice pack for about fifteen minutes every two hours, in the initial few days.
Most people favor the application of heat, but this tends to cause more harm in the initial couple of days.
The purpose of ice is to bring down the inflammation and swelling.
In a few days, you can change to heat by having a hot shower or perhaps availing of a heating pad.
For lower back pain treatment, hot water bottles are also wonderful devices.
Several over-the-counter drugs like Ibuprofen, Tylenol, or Advil, may be quite effective in reducing the pain.
In fact they act best when taken regularly at the very start of the pain.
Never wait till the pain becomes intolerable and then expect an immediate cure.
Get as much rest as you can in the initial few days.
In case you are lying in bed, attempt to sleep on your side, your knees resting on a pillow.
If you actually wish to sleep on your back, then lie down on the floor and have your knees resting on pillows to ensure improved circulation.
Bed rest in cases of lower back treatment should not last more than one or two days.
Once that period is over, it is better to return to your regular schedule as far as possible.
Doing exercise like walking is an excellent treatment for lower back pain.
In case you consult a physical therapist, he will usually tell you to perform particular exercises as well as stretches to assist you with your back and avert possible problems in the future.
